MLR Week 18 Previews and Predictions

Week 17 produced a huge upset with the Houston SaberCats taking down NOLA Gold on their home ground. Seattle Seawolves ran out convincing winners against the Glendale raptors despite the Raptors showing some good form recently while San Diego clinched victory over Utah, thereby securing their place in the last 4 championship. RUNY also defeated Austin Elite Rugby to push them into 4th position.

Week 18 sees four more exciting match-ups with bottom two Houston SaberCats taking on Austin Elite on Saturday. Three games take place on Sunday with Toronto Arrows hosting Glendale Raptors, Utah Warriors are away to Seattle Seawolves. The game of the weekend sees RUNY host NOLA Gold in what should be an epic encounter.

Houston SaberCats Vs Austin Elite Rugby

This Texas derby has the added spice of being a bottom of the table clash. While Austin have been eluded by that all evasive win all season, one feels as though this could be their best opportunity as the Elite play the Seattle Seawolves the following week who will surely be pushing hard for that playoff spot.
This will have been a thoroughly disappointing season for Austin Elite Rugby. It could have been a different story for them if they had beaten NOLA Gold back in March. Who knows what impact that would have had on the Elite’s confidence, who knows if that could have given them the springboard to push on and compete to a higher standard but it wasn’t to be.
There is still a lot to play for these Austin players. The Elite will surely not want to be in this position next year and players could be playing for contracts at this stage of the season.

The SaberCats pulled off the upset of the weekend last weekend when they beat NOLA Gold 27-20, in what was only their third victory all season. The SaberCats like Austin will be hoping to finish the season on a high with a victory over their Texas rivals. The SaberCats play the Utah Warriors in the final weekend of the 2019 MLR season so there is the opportunity to climb up to 7th and go into the 2020 season with a bit more confidence.

Prediction: Houston SaberCats

RUNY Vs NOLA Gold

RUNY eased past Austin Elite last week to give them 3 wins from their last 5 games but more importantly the win pushed them into 4th place in standings and in the hot-seat for the championship playoff position. RUNY are currently one point ahead of the Toronto Arrows who are in fifth position. RUNY also play the Arrows the following week, so if both teams get a win this weekend, that showdown could be immense.

NOLA Gold’s slip up last weekend against the Houston SaberCats has been systematic of a worrying trend in form. The Gold are currently 2 wins from 5 having lost their last 2 games. The Gold are currently in second position but the with Seawolves only a point behind them and RUNY 3 points behind them, it is all to play for.
NOLA Gold are at home to San Diego Legion in the final game of the regular season next weekend so they will be hoping to get a result out of at least one of those games.

The last time these sides met was back in February where RUNY ran out victors 27-24 over the Gold, momentum however could play a role in this game and one suspects a repeat of a tight encounter with RUNY to edge it.

Prediction: RUNY.

Toronto Arrows Vs Glendale Raptors

The Toronto Arrows are currently the most in form team in the MLR with 5 wins from 5. The Arrows had a strategically beneficial week off last week and with games against the Raptors this weekend and RUNY next weekend, it could be set up for the Arrows to just about make the playoffs.
The Arrows have had some impressive victories in the past few weeks with wins against San Diego Legion and a convincing win against Seattle Seawolves as they have shown they can take down the big teams as well as the teams further down the table.

The Raptors are in decent form with 3 wins from their last five and wins over RUNY and Utah Warriors recently but last weeks 36-53 loss to Seattle Seawolves will have taken the wind out of the Raptors sails.
The manner of the loss will have been particularly disappointing the Raptors as the Seawolves ran in a couple of relatively easy tries.
The big question for the Raptors is can they bounce back from this type of defeat. The Raptors do have an outside chance of making the playoffs as they have a re-scheduled game against the SaberCats on Wednesday May 29th, they would need to pick up two bonus point wins and hope for other surrounding teams to slip up.

Prediction: Toronto Arrows.

Seattle Seawolves Vs Utah Warriors

Seattle enter week 18 in third place in the standings and only a point behind second place NOLA Gold. The Seawolves have had an impressive run of form, winning 4 of their last 5 games and racking up some notable victories against RUNY, Glendale and NOLA along the way.
With the Seawolves taking on the Utah Warriors this weekend and Austin Elite Rugby next weekend, their vision of the path to the playoffs could be clearer than the other teams vying for a playoff position.

The Warriors on the other hand have not had a good run of form. The Warriors have lost 4 of their last 5 games, with a sole victory coming against the Austin Elite in April. The Warriors are currently in 7th place but are 26 points behind 6th place Glendale Raptors. Aside from a battle of pride between the Warriors and Sabercats as to who gets 7th place, the Warriors do not have a whole lot to play for.

Prediction: Seattle Seawolves.
